Hello! My name is Sean O'Brien (He/Him) and I’m an  Illustrator based in Brighton, UK. I work from a shared studio space in the Phoenix Art Space.

I’m a big fan of mark making and traditional drawing, and realy enjoy using humour, staging and a playful colour palette to visually communicate ideas through my illustration work. 

I have a profound love of being outside in nature, which is reflected in my work. I’ll make any excuse to draw loads of plants! Aside from that, I enjoy working on topics such as Science, Technology and Sports.

I’ve also co-directed two projects with Minute Books, which were featured on It's Nice That and also the Observer.
